Output 8c89bfb72396527052eeef0a2146f19429ba3ab09cb625877a17a7707d34badc:0

value
876808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b319e8056081ba46801e48c78059ec07e78b9a OP_EQUAL
address
3EhYRxE4UHpnKxY8pDJLroSXRqD7i8uQUB
transaction
8c89bfb72396527052eeef0a2146f19429ba3ab09cb625877a17a7707d34badc
spent
true